let's turn your ideas into realty .
Build
Your Next
Project

Progressive Web Apps (PWAs) & Custom Web Development: What You Should Know

Businesses today are constantly seeking innovative ways to connect with their audience, enhance user experience, and drive growth. Among the factors driving this change are two key strategies: Progressive Web Apps and custom web development services. While both aim to deliver exceptional online experiences, understanding their fundamentals and how they complement each other is crucial for any business looking to thrive.

Understanding Progressive Web Apps

Progressive Web Apps represent a revolutionary approach to web development, blending the best features of traditional websites with the rich functionality and user experience of native mobile applications. They are essentially websites that are progressively enhanced to provide app-like features to users.

What Makes PWAs Unique

PWAs stand out due to a set of core characteristics that mimic native app functionality:

  • Reliable: They load instantly, regardless of network conditions, even offline. This is thanks to service workers that cache essential resources.
  • Fast: PWAs respond quickly to user interactions with silky smooth animations and an immersive experience.
  • Engaging: They offer an immersive user experience, like a native app, and can even be added to a device's home screen.
  • Discoverable: As websites, they are discoverable via search engines, unlike native apps, which are confined to app stores.
  • Progressive: They function seamlessly across all browsers, thanks to their foundation in progressive enhancement principles.
  • Installable: Users can "install" them to their home screen without the hassle of an app store, making them easily accessible.

Technologies Powering PWAs

The magic behind PWAs is powered by a combination of modern web technologies:

  • Service Workers: These are critical scripts that run in the background, separate from the web page, enabling features like offline access, push notifications, and background data synchronization.
  • Web App Manifest: A JSON file that provides information about the application (like its name, icons, start URL, etc.) to the browser, allowing the PWA to be installed on the home screen and appear like a native app.
  • HTTPS: Essential for security, ensuring data integrity and user privacy. PWAs must be served over HTTPS to enable service workers and other advanced features.
  • App Shell Architecture: A design pattern that separates the application's core UI from its content. The shell is loaded quickly and cached by service workers, providing instant loading times and a consistent user experience.

How PWAs Benefit Businesses

Adopting PWAs offers a multitude of advantages for businesses looking to expand their digital footprint and optimize user engagement.

Better Performance and SEO

PWAs are fast due to service worker caching and optimized loading. This improves user experience, reducing bounce rates and encouraging longer sessions. Search engines prioritize fast-loading websites, giving PWAs an advantage in search engine rankings. Their web-like discoverability, combined with app-like performance, creates a powerful combination for online visibility.

Cost-Effective & Cross-Platform

Developing and maintaining separate native apps for iOS and Android can be expensive and time-consuming. PWAs offer a single codebase that works across all platforms, devices, and browsers. This significantly reduces development costs, speeds up time-to-market, and simplifies maintenance, making PWAs a cost-effective solution for small businesses.

Enhanced Engagement

With features like push notifications, offline capability, and home screen installation, PWAs increase user engagement. Push notifications allow businesses to directly re-engage users with timely updates and promotions, similar to native apps. The ability to access content offline ensures a consistent experience, even in areas with poor connectivity.

Real-World Success Stories

Many prominent companies have successfully implemented PWAs, reporting impressive results:

  • Make My Trip: The Make My Trip PWA drove a 3x increase in conversions over the mobile site within six months, achieving almost the same performance as the native app. (Think with Google)
  • Alibaba: Alibaba saw a 76% increase in conversions across browsers post-PWA implementation. (BigCommerce)
  • Blibli: Blibli's PWA drove 10x more revenue per user compared to its previous mobile website. (Web.dev)

Why Partner with a Custom Web Application Development Company

While the benefits of PWAs are clear, successful implementation often requires specialized expertise. Partnering with a custom PWA development company is crucial for ensuring your application meets your specific business needs and delivers maximum impact.

Tailored Development Process

A custom web application development company works closely with you to understand your unique business goals, target audience, and existing infrastructure. They don't just build a generic PWA; they craft a solution tailored to your exact requirements, integrating seamlessly with your brand identity and operational workflows.

SEO-Focused Architecture

Custom developers understand the intricacies of SEO for local businesses and build PWAs with search engine visibility in mind. This includes implementing proper schema markup, optimizing loading speeds, and structuring content for maximum discoverability. This approach ensures your PWA performs well in search rankings, driving organic traffic.

Long-Term Support & Scalability

A reliable development partner provides ongoing maintenance, security updates, and performance optimizations. They also build PWAs with scalability in mind, ensuring your application can grow and adapt as your business needs change, accommodating increased traffic, new features, and future technological advancements without requiring a complete overhaul.

As a leading progressive web app development company, CSIPL has helped numerous clients transform their digital presence. Their client work and case studies show how they deliver fast, reliable, and engaging PWAs that set industry standards.

Frequently Asked Questions (FAQs)

What is the difference between a PWA and a traditional web app?

A Progressive Web App (PWA) combines the accessibility of a website with app-like experiences, including offline functionality, push notifications, and faster load times, unlike traditional web apps which are limited to online use.

Can a PWA improve SEO rankings?

Yes. PWAs are indexable by search engines like standard websites. Their fast load speeds, mobile responsiveness, and improved user engagement can positively influence search engine rankings.

Can my current website be converted into a PWA?

Absolutely. Existing websites can be upgraded into PWAs by adding a service worker, web app manifest, and enabling offline capabilities, providing app-like features without rebuilding from scratch.

Why choose CSIPL for PWA development?

CSIPL offers expertise in creating fast, reliable, and engaging PWAs using modern web technologies, ensuring seamless performance, cross-platform compatibility, and tailored solutions aligned with your business goals.

Are Progressive Web Apps compatible with all devices?

PWAs are designed to be device-agnostic, working across desktops, smartphones, and tablets, regardless of operating system, delivering a consistent user experience on almost any modern device.

How secure are Progressive Web Apps compared to native apps?

PWAs use HTTPS for secure data transmission, sandboxed service workers, and modern web security practices, providing robust security comparable to native apps while reducing risks from untrusted sources.

What are the key technologies used in developing PWAs?

PWAs rely on HTML, CSS, and JavaScript, along with service workers, web app manifests, and responsive frameworks to deliver offline capabilities, push notifications, and app-like experiences.

Author Bio

Dr. Aarav Sharma

PhD in Computer Science from IIT Delhi